Epilepsy & Photosensitivity

  • A very small percentage of people may experience seizures when exposed to certain visual patterns, flashing lights, or rapidly changing images.

  • This risk may be higher for individuals with a history of epilepsy or other photosensitive conditions.

  • If you or anyone in your family has experienced seizures, consult a doctor before playing.

Stop Immediately if You Experience:

  • Dizziness

  • Altered vision

  • Eye or muscle twitches

  • Loss of awareness

  • Disorientation

  • Seizures or convulsions

If any of these symptoms occur, stop playing immediately and seek medical attention if necessary.

Play Responsibly

  • Take regular breaks (every 30–60 minutes).

  • Ensure the play area is well-lit.

  • Sit a comfortable distance from the screen.

  • Adjust brightness/contrast in the settings if you feel discomfort.
